Now that record labels have stopped making money because you can just stream everything for free, the record income has shrunken hugely and so has tour support for bands. The labels cant afford to put their bands on tour and therefore the price of a band now is three or four times more than it was five years ago because that revenue stream has to come from somewhere else for the band to keep touring. The other side of this is that acts are signed to festivals not to play the vicinity of the festivalsometimes even in the same countyor they can only play one show in a six week period, therefore eliminating their ability to play other shows anywhere in the country. We paid 20% on all of our tickets to the government in tax and then give up 80% of our profit to the bands, thats 100% gone. If something isnt done the bottom end of the music industry will collapse and there will only be venues of 500 capacity and above, which is no good for bands starting out because shows in those venues are too expensive to run when bands are just starting out and would be mostly empty. We grow bands to being able to sell 200 or 300 tickets, but because there isnt then a venue for the next step up we then lose bands to cities like Portsmouth and Bournemouth and to national promoters like Live Nation and AMG. As soon as the Isle of Wight Festival begins, no-one tours and we cant get bands in so we tend to rely on local bands to keep us going over the summer. So that revenue now has to come from the live sector, which is ticketing, which is us.
